A simple mesh could stop a common complication after liver transplants

NCT ID NCT07744230

First seen Aug 04, 2026 · Last updated Aug 05, 2026 · Updated 1 time

Summary

This study tests whether placing a bio-absorbable mesh during liver transplant surgery can prevent incisional hernias—bulges that can form at the surgical cut—in patients at high risk. About 100 adults who have at least three risk factors (like older age, obesity, or diabetes) will receive the mesh as part of their transplant procedure. Researchers will track how many develop a hernia over two years, along with any surgical complications.

What could go wrong
The trial is a case series without a comparison group, so results may not prove the mesh is better than standard care. Mesh can also cause complications like infection or seroma.
